Project Manager Tech information

How does a Project Manager Tech typ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during a project lifecycle?

A Project Manager Tech works closely with teams such as software developers, QA engineers, UX designers, and business analysts to ensure project milestones are met. They facilitate regular stand-ups, sprint planning, and review meetings to track progress and address blockers. By acting as a communication bridge between technical staff and stakeholders, they help clarify requirements, manage expectations, and resolve conflicts. This collaborative approach is key to delivering projects on time and within scope.

What does a Project Manager in Tech do?

A Project Manager in Tech is responsible for planning, executing, and closing technology-related projects. They coordinate teams, manage timelines, set budgets, and ensure that project goals align with business objectives. Their work often involves communicating between technical and non-technical stakeholders, identifying risks, and adapting plans as needed. Ultimately, they help ensure projects are delivered on time, within scope, and on budget.

What is the difference between Project Manager Tech vs Software Project Manager?

AspectProject Manager TechSoftware Project Manager
CertificationsPMP, CAPM, Agile/Scrum certificationsPMP, Agile/Scrum certifications
Work EnvironmentTechnology projects across various industriesSoftware development teams and IT projects
Industry UsageIT, telecommunications, tech servicesSoftware companies, app development
Job FocusManaging tech projects, infrastructure, hardwareManaging software development lifecycle

Both roles require similar certifications and often work in tech environments, but Project Manager Tech oversees a broader range of technology projects, including hardware and infrastructure, while Software Project Managers focus specifically on software development projects.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Project Manager in Tech,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Project Manager in Tech, you need expertise in project planning, risk management, and a solid understanding of software development life cycles, typically supported by a degree in a relevant field and project management certifications like PMP or Scrum Master. Familiarity with tools such as Jira, Trello, Microsoft Project, and Agile methodologies is essential for tracking progress and facilitating collaboration. Exceptional communication, leadership, and problem-solving skills help drive teams towards shared goals and adapt to changing project demands. These abilities are crucial for delivering projects on time, within scope, and to the satisfaction of stakeholders in a dynamic tech environment.

Job description

Job ID: 22-11641 Duties:
DESCRIPTION
Manages large and/or multiple projects with significant impact on business processes and technology used firm wide.
Influences strategic direction and develops tactical plans with substantial latitude.
Provides comprehensive solutions to complex problems and has extensive contact with internal clients and the business.
Manages complex projects from proposal and requirements definition to project planning and implementation, using broad and extensive input from industry and/or business unit subject matter experts.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
โ€ข Conducts preliminary investigation for all project requests by reviewing requirements and specifications and testing and by reviewing support and training plans to ensure they are aligned with organizational priorities, business plans and objectives.
โ€ข Provides a proactive interface between project stakeholders and senior management team to ensure complete and accurate definitions of business requirements and delivery of business applications.
โ€ข Identifies, defines and documents complex business and technical requirements, processes and deliverables.
โ€ข Develops, prepares, presents and maintains project plans, including staffing requirements, cost estimates, detailed budgets and work breakdown structures and schedules.
โ€ข Performs project risk assessments, including identifying key risk factors, providing effective mitigation strategies and assigning contingency action plans to both schedules and budgets
โ€ข Manages projects and teams, including applying established methodologies, using change control templates and processes; managing time and recording activities using defined scheduling tools; monitoring budgets; coordinating resource acquisition and utilization; serving as a liaison with internal customers and external suppliers; and communicating regularly with project stakeholders.
โ€ข Delivers systems on appropriate platforms in compliance with established technology standards, including monitoring testing, executing quality assurance checks and ensuring information technology acceptance criteria is met prior to implementation.
Skills:
EXPERIENCE AND SKILLS:
โ€ข Minimum of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, MIS or applicable degree and seven years of experience including project management, enterprise implementation, leadership experience, strategic planning, business acumen, applications development, and change management or combination of education, training and experience.
โ€ข PMP or equivalent certification is highly preferred. Knowledge of the following:
o Application development and project life cycle methodologies and standards.
o Project selection and approvals; budgeting and business case preparation and analysis; and project initiation and planning, including work breakdown structures and forecasting.
o Concepts of risk management, issue tracking, change management and requirements gathering.
o Information technology support and technical documentation.
o Principles of banking and finance and securities industry operations.
o Business planning and analysis.
o Project budget interfaces with other accounting systems.
COMPETENCIES:
โ€ข Analysis: Identify and understand issues, problems and opportunities; compare data from different sources to draw conclusions.
โ€ข Communication: Clearly convey information and ideas through a variety of media to individuals or groups in a manner that engages the audience and helps them understand and retain the message.
โ€ข Exercising Judgment and Decision Making: Use effective approaches for choosing a course of action or developing appropriate solutions; recommend or take action that is consistent with available facts, constraints and probable consequences.
โ€ข Technical and Professional Knowledge: Demonstrate a satisfactory level of technical and professional skill or knowledge in position-related areas; remains current with developments and trends in areas of expertise.
โ€ข Building Effective Relationships: Develop and use collaborative relationships to facilitate the accomplishment of work goals.
โ€ข Client Focus: Make internal and external clients and their needs a primary focus of actions; develop and sustain productive client relationships.
